PRN MRI Technician - PPMC

Penn Medicine is dedicated to providing high-quality patient care and innovative research. They are seeking a PRN MRI Technologist to join the Radiology team at Penn Presbyterian Medical Center, where the role involves performing MRI and MRA procedures, ensuring patient safety, and assisting Radiologists in diagnostic procedures.

Responsibilities

Performs all necessary checks of diagnosis, prescription, Epic order and patient identification as demonstrated by documentation
Greets patients--confirming their identifications performing the correct procedures as directed and completely explaining the procedure to patient and family as directed
Obtains patient history, screens patients for any and all surgeries and implanted items, explains procedures, gains consent for contrast and verifies GFR as needed, and addresses patient concerns as demonstrated by documentation and feedback
Place angiocatheters, inject IV MRI contrast agents as directed by the Radiologist
Operates the MRI scanner and all RF coils, MRI workstations, patient monitoring equipment and MR injectors to produce high quality images
Archive and Verify MRI images to hard-copy format as needed
Performs quality assurance testing consistent with section protocols
Monitors the patient’s status, tolerance and wellbeing throughout the study
Aids radiologists, doctors and other UPHS team members in completing procedures according to applicable protocol
Compliance with OSHA, TJC, DOH and other mandated safety procedures or regulations
Maintains necessary inventory supplies for assigned workstation, rotating stock in an orderly fashion and eliminating outdated items
Responds to emergency situations according to department policies
Establishes and maintains good working relationships and partnerships within the facility and with outside customers of our services
Communicate equipment problems and image quality issues

Required

H.S. Diploma/GED (required)
Graduate of an approved Radiologic and/or MRI Resonance technology program (required)
American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) registered in MRI or taken within the first year of employment (required)
MRI Certification (required)

Preferred

CT Certification (preferred)
CPR (preferred)
